LinkLinks WAMU: D.C.’s Newest And Tallest Mural Honors A Local Jazz Legend Who Was Also A Mailman By Editor On Aug 28, 2019 Last updated Aug 28, 2019 16 Share A man in a U.S. Postal Service uniform leans against a brick wall at 14th and U Streets NW. He’s playing a tenor saxophone, with his mailbag resting at his feet. He’s also nine stories tall. 16 Share FacebookTwitterReddItWhatsAppEmailPrint
